General Liability Insurance in Santa Ana: State Requirements & Local Regulations

In California, General Liability Insurance is regulated by the California Department of Insurance (CDI). Businesses must adhere to the California Insurance Code, which outlines the requirements for maintaining adequate liability coverage. The CDI mandates minimum liability limits, often starting at $1 million per occurrence and $2 million aggregate, though specific needs may vary based on industry and risk exposure. Compliance with these regulations is crucial for operating legally and protecting against potential claims that could arise from business operations.

Major employers and public agencies in Santa Ana, such as the Santa Ana Unified School District and the County of Orange, often require contractors and vendors to provide proof of General Liability Insurance. These entities typically mandate coverage limits of at least $1 million per occurrence to ensure adequate protection against potential claims. Businesses seeking contracts with these organizations must provide insurance certificates that meet specified requirements, highlighting the importance of maintaining appropriate coverage levels for successful partnerships.
